Relied upon to hunt down the ball, blitz opponents and make reckless unsupported runs towards the endzone, Paravel is something of a hero for Emmets supporters, not least for the manner in which he routinely faces up to much stronger opponents.

Showing an distinctly un-elf-like lack of fear, the Dragon Warrior is most frequently found in the heart of the scrum, averaging more than six blocks per game as he regularly illustrates that he is not one for shirking close contact with the opposition.

** Did You Know **: Nurdainion stakes a claim to scoring the first touchdown for the Emmets - unfortunately, his effort came in an unofficial match, leaving Ramagris to claim the accolade after the Lineman scored the team's first recognised effort.

Poached from the youth academy of a team in Averlorn, Emerel Pellaorodion endured a protracted saga at the beginning of his Emmets campaign as his case was routinely taken to the Orc of Arbitration in Sport. Luckily, the green-skinned judiciary eventually settled in favour of the player's new team, allowing him to continue his career as a thrower with great potential.

Nicknamed "The Arm of Averlorn", Emerel is perhaps the best import from another region of Ulthuan that the Emmets possess, and is an increasingly useful asset to the team.

A player who quickly showed aptitude for both the defensive and offensive aspects of the game, Ramagris is no stranger to close encounters with the opposition and shows a helpful toughness when inevitably flattened by stronger opponents.

Unfortunately, his status as the team's star player early in the Emmets' career resulted in his being targeted by opposition supporters, with the player frequently the target for thrown rocks. Thankfully, he has survived the best efforts of savage Blood Bowl crowds thus far.

** Did You Know **: Ramagris was the first Emmets player to score a touchdown, scoring the equaliser against Transilvania Patriots.

As the team's oldest player, Nuinaduial Enhiriel often found himself the brunt of many jokes from his team-mates after it became apparent that he still hadn't figued out how to block opponents properly.

Thankfully, five games into his Emmets career the lineman found himself in a gruelling midfield battle with the undead, and emerged from the experience having finally picked it up. Unfortunately, he now also routinely complains about his creaky old back, which threatens to keep him out of a game at a moment's notice.
